I cut the barrel about one and a half inches from where the barrel reduces to become the tailpipe. When separated, the end section comes away with the perforated tube attached. The other end of the perforated tube has a disk attached (like a bobbin end) that just slides into the silencer barrel and retains the sound absorbing wrapping. If the barrel is cut elsewhere, it may not be possible to wrap the sound absorbing material around the tube properly before inserting into the silencer barrel. I joined the two parts together using a Jubilee Super Clamp, about £3.50 online. One could sleeve the barrel internally and attach the two parts with self tappers or pop rivets.
I had a 1948 Scott sidecar outfit and coming back home from my RAF camp the first weekend of ownership, I was driving through Stratford in London, when, having stopped at traffic lights, I let out the clutch and reversed straight back into a bus! The ignition was obviously over advanced and if you let the revs drop at tick-over to nearly stalling and then snapped the throttle open, the engine would run in reverse. I used this trick many times to either entertain or to reverse out of a parking space. A word of warning though: One day the engine started running on one cylinder, I thought it was an oiled plug but what had happened was the r/h big end screw had come undone allowing the race plate to drop down off the bush and scythe it’s way through the crankcase and blow out a 3″ x 1/2″ section of the case. The lock washer, if there was one, obviously didn’t do it’s job. I still have the crankcase on a shed in the garage 64 years later!

The reason I suggested head bearings Stan, was because some years ago I was riding my 1938 Prototype Clubman Scott quite fast over a not too smooth a track at a Beaulieu Motor Museum show and the girder forks started juddering quite badly as if they we’re bottoming out, especially when braking. No problems on normal roads. When I got home and checked them out, I found the forks and spring were ok but a fair amount of play had developed in the head bearings. Bearings and cups were replaced and the problem disappeared.

The “bolt” head is 3/4″ diameter with no spanner flats, relying on flats engaging with the brake anchor slot to prevent it rotating. The threaded portion of the bolt is 11/16″ long and is 1/2″ diameter with a 1/2″ cycle thread. The long shanked domed nut is 1 1/4″ long and 3/4″ diameter on its shank. It also has an undersized head that takes a 7/16″ BSF spanner. The hole in the frame lug is 1/2″ dia. and there shouldn’t be a gap between it and the brake anchor plate. Check your rear wheel alignment.
